  • Patent number: 6133521
    Abstract: The solar battery output section has a hole provided through the substrate and through an output terminal formed on the front-side of that substrate. Metal foil is applied covering the hole on the backside of the substrate. The inside of the hole is filled with conducting material to electrically connect the output terminal and the metal foil. Finally, a protective resin film is applied over the substrate, and a wire lead is solder attached to the metal foil on the backside of the substrate.

  • Patent number: 5262695
    Abstract: An electrostatic motor for use as a power generating mechanism to be mounted on a micromachine includes a rotatable semiconductor substrate and a drive electrode disposed in proximity to the substrate. The semiconductor substrate is doped with a specified impurity element to form electromagnetic wave-static electric converters of p-n junction. When the motor is to be started, the converter in the vicinity of the electrode is irradiated with electromagnetic waves to set up an electric field between the opposed surfaces of the converter and the electrode to rotate the substrate by an electrostatic force due to the electric field.

  • Patent number: 5114498
    Abstract: A photovoltaic device includes a substrate (1, 10) having a conductive electrode (2, 10), and a first semiconductor layer (3.sub.1, 11.sub.1) of a first conductivity type, a substantially intrinsic second semiconductor layer (3.sub.2, 11.sub.2) and a third semiconductor layer (3.sub.3, 11.sub.3) of the opposite conductivity type successively deposited on the conductive electrode. The hydrogen content in at least the first and second semiconductor layer (3.sub.1, 11.sub.1) is 10% or less. At least the second semiconductor layer (3.sub.2, 11.sub.2), is made of an amorphous semiconductor layer.
